General contractor and remodeler
A general contractor oversees construction projects, managing all aspects from start to finish. This includes coordinating subcontractors, sourcing materials, ensuring codes and regulations are met, and ensuring the project stays on budget and on schedule. They often handle residential renovations, new home builds, and larger commercial projects. Hiring a general contractor ensures expert supervision and streamlines communication, helping ensure the job is completed efficiently and professionally.

General contractors should hold proper licensing from state or local authorities, depending on their location. Licensing ensures they meet local building codes and safety standards. Many states also require insurance for liability and workers’ compensation. For additional credibility, contractors may pursue certifications like LEED accreditation for sustainable construction or CGP (Certified Green Professional) credentials.
